Repeal the Zero Tolerance Policy within schools.

Created by B.H. on November 11, 2012

The Zero Tolerance policy states that schools will not allow violence of any kind within school grounds whether it be fighting of any nature, harassment or anything deemed to be a weapon regardless of the severity of the incident or however unlikely the item is to being a weapon.

-This policy contradicts the ability to defend oneself.

-Minor transgressions of this policy are often met with severe punishment and disciplinary action

-There are victims of the Zero Tolerance policy, such as myself, and other well intended students who are wrongfully denied the right to defend oneself and are being punished as much as and along with the perpetrators.

-This policy shows a lack of care for people it was intended.

-This policy was put in place without the consent of the overall student body.
